HONOUR: From left - 'The Voice's' managing director Paulette Simpson, JN Bank's Leon Mitchell and Usain Bolt, who was presented with a commemorative citation (image credit: Ken Passley)

THIS TIME last week, readers, the sports world, politicians and personalities direct from Jamaica as well as London joined The Voice and JN Bank in welcoming the incomparable Usain Bolt and his coach Glen Mills to the capital and your emails of thanks have been pouring-in ever since.

Dubbed #BoltMillsLondon on social media, posts about the event trended on Twitter in London.

Guests enjoyed a sumptuous three-course meal before bidding on top-tier prizes such as Bolt's personal spikes and other memorabilia donated by the star athlete, the Premier League and Ethiopian Airlines to name a few. Proceeds from each bid went to the Racers charity, directly benefitting future athletes who train at Bolt's club in Jamaica.

Host Colin Jackson, The Voice's sports editor Rodney Hinds and Leon Hamilton of JN Bank were among those who took to the stage to say a few words about Bolt and present him with some commemorative tokens to keep ahead of his retirement next month.
